Our first on the list to visit is the Roman Bath. When we arrived there wasn’t any queue at all around nine in the morning. Visitors have an option to book online to avoid the queue, however, in our case we just came early to get accomodated. Spent around forty pounds for two adults and one child entrance fee. I would say the amount is worth it. The Roman Bath is so amazing to see especially for kids. They will surely enjoy it.

They lent us a little phone where we can press the numbers to hear the historical background of each place inside the Roman Bath. Akyn had so much fun listening to it.
